Hi, I have reached my goal and instead of going straight to maintenance recommended calorie intake I increased a little over the last two weeks. However I have continued losing, which i don't want to do. So today I have went with MFP's recommendation, but it seems a big jump, and I am a bit scared of putting on weight. I know this sounds daft, because I expect there will be some fluctuation until it finally settles. I was just wondering if anyone else has these feelings. I would also love to hear of other people's experience when going on to maintenance. Thanks.

    Well, it's a bit late now but when you were getting close to your goal I would have slowly increased to maintenance so it didn't seem like a big jump. You can still do that now, just don't hop on the scale for about a month and see where you're at :)
